斷線重連機制是ActiveMQ的高可用性具體體現之一。ActiveMQ提供failover機制去實現斷線重連的高可用性,可以使得連接斷開之后,不斷的重試連接到一個或多個brokerURL。 默認情況下,如果client與broker直接的connection斷開,則client會新起一個線程 ...
花了一天的時間,終於搞明白了我的疑問。 failover: tcp: localhost: randomize false amp initialReconnectDelay amp timeout failover: tcp: localhost: wireFormat.maxInactivityDuration amp maxReconnectDelay amp maxReconnectAt ...
2017-02-13 10:17 0 1869 推薦指數:
斷線重連機制是ActiveMQ的高可用性具體體現之一。ActiveMQ提供failover機制去實現斷線重連的高可用性,可以使得連接斷開之后,不斷的重試連接到一個或多個brokerURL。 默認情況下,如果client與broker直接的connection斷開,則client會新起一個線程 ...
連接字符串配置成:failover:(tcp://primary:61616,tcp://secondary:61616)?randomize=false 詳情參見:http://activemq.apache.org/failover-transport-reference.html ...
曾問過我,你知道ActiveMQ中的消息重發時間間隔和重發次數嗎?我當時尷尬了,只知道會重發,還真沒去 ...
文章轉自:http://www.linuxidc.com/Linux/2013-02/79664.htm 1.JMS消息確認機制 JMS消息只有在被確認之后,才認為已經被成功地消費了。消息的成功消費通常包含三個階段:客戶接收消息、客戶處理消息和消息被確認。在事務性會話中,當一個事務被提交 ...
3、消息被簽收 其中,第三階段的簽收可以有ActiveMQ發起,也可以由消費者客戶端 ...
1.ActiveMQ重試機制是什么? 消費者收到消息,之后出現異常了,沒有告訴broker確認收到該消息,broker會嘗試再將該消息發送給消費者。嘗試n次,如果消費者還是沒有確認收到該消息,那么該消息將被放到死信隊列中,之后broker不會再將該消息發送給消費者。 2.具體哪些情況會引發 ...
ActiveMQ支持多種通訊協議TCP/UDP等,我們選取最常用的TCP來分析ActiveMQ的通訊機制。首先我們來明確一個概念: 客戶(Client):消息的生產者、消費者對ActiveMQ來說都叫作客戶。 消息中介(Message broker):接收消息並進行相關處理 ...
摘要: dubbo啟動時默認有重試機制和超時機制。 超時機制的規則是如果在一定的時間內,provider沒有返回,則認為本次調用失敗, 重試機制在出現調用失敗時,會再次調用。如果在配置的調用次數內都失敗,則認為此次請求異常,拋出異常。 dubbo啟動時默認有重試機制和超時機制。超時機制 ...